Pedro Merchant, Murder, New York 2018

Long Island resident Pedro Merchant, a member of the Outlaws street gang, has been sentenced to 20 years’ imprisonment for his role in the murder of 17-year-old Dante Quinones.

According to court records, on September 11, 2013, Merchant and fellow Outlaws gang members confronted Quinones on Dartmouth Street in Hempstead to determine where Quinones’ allegiance lay between the Outlaws gang and their rivals, the Bloods.

During the confrontation, Merchant pulled out a handgun and shot Quinones several times at close range, killing him.

The murder was part of a violent gang war that ensued between the Outlaws and the Bloods in Hempstead, with numerous shootings and violent incidents occurring in the area.

Merchant was initially tried and acquitted of murdering Quinones in 2015 in a Nassau County trial marked by witness intimidation by Merchant’s associates.

However, following the acquittal, Merchant and six additional members and associates of the Outlaws and six members of the Bloods were charged federally in this district for their participation in the violent gang war.

Merchant was subsequently sentenced to 20 years’ imprisonment for his role in Quinones’ murder, with United States Attorney Richard P. Donoghue stating, ‘With today’s sentence Merchant is being held accountable for the senseless act he committed—taking a human life in the name of his gang, which also put an entire community on Long Island in danger.’

FBI Assistant Director-in-Charge William F. Sweeney, Jr. added, ‘In the midst of the Outlaws’ declared war on a rival gang, Merchant shot and killed his victim and, at the same time, put the lives of innocent people in danger.’

Nassau County Police Commissioner Patrick J. Ryder stated, ‘Nassau County is no place for the illegal and dangerous actions of gang members, in particular, Pedro Merchant.’
